9.2.3 Battery Temperature Sensor
The battery temperature sensor is used to detect the battery temperature. With this function, we can adjust the float charging
voltage of the battery to make it inversely proportional to the ambient temperature of the battery, so as to prevent the over-
charge of the battery at high ambient temperature.
Installation preparation
1. Tools: one cross head screwdriver.
2. Check whether the installation materials are all set, including: one battery temperature sensor.
Installation steps

1. Power down the UPS completely.
a. Turn off the load.
b. All UPS indication goes off, wait five minutes for the internal DC bus capacitors of the UPS to discharge
completely.
2. Connect one end of the network cable with shielded RJ45 port to the battery temperature sensor and plug the
other end into the J2 dry contact port on the UPS bypass. The temperature sensor can be connected in series
with a maximum of 20 sensors and a maximum distance of 50m.
3. Route and pack the cables in order. Note that the cables should be routed separately from the power cables, to
avoid EMI.
9.2.4 Battery Ground Fault Kit
The UPS provides a battery ground fault detector to detect and remove battery ground fault so as to ensure reliable system
operation.
When a battery ground fault is detected, an alarm will appear on the UPS display panel.
The battery ground fault detector includes a mutual inductor and a PCB, which should be installed in the BCB box. For the
